The Historical Significance of "Bhinneka Tunggal Ika"

The origins of "Bhinneka Tunggal Ika" can be traced back to the 14th century, during the reign of Majapahit King Hayam Wuruk. The phrase, originally a verse from the ancient Javanese text "Sutasoma," encapsulates the essence of the Majapahit kingdom's philosophy of tolerance and inclusivity. It was adopted as the national motto of Indonesia in 1945, signifying the nation's commitment to unity despite its diverse cultural and ethnic makeup.

The Essence of "Bhinneka Tunggal Ika"

"Bhinneka Tunggal Ika" is more than just a slogan; it is a profound philosophical concept that underscores the importance of embracing diversity while maintaining unity. It recognizes the inherent beauty and strength that lie in the differences among individuals and communities. The motto emphasizes that despite our variations, we are all bound together by a shared sense of national identity and purpose.

The Challenges to "Bhinneka Tunggal Ika"

Despite its profound significance, the principle of "Bhinneka Tunggal Ika" faces challenges in the contemporary world. The rise of identity politics, religious extremism, and social media-fueled polarization can threaten the delicate balance of unity and diversity. It is essential to actively combat these forces by promoting interfaith dialogue, fostering cultural exchange, and promoting tolerance and understanding.
